The wife and I have an early afternoon second meal (the first being breakfast) and nothing else. We frequent a small number of restaurants in Nan and in the case of Crazy Noodle, decided to try it because it was always busy, queues onto the street busy at times. Since we eat there at least twice a week they now prepare my preferred dish without us ordering. This is a BIG bowl of tom yum based broth with yellow noodles, pork bone, pork meat, pork larb, bean sprouts, beans, dried pork rind, turnip (I think), crushed peanuts and as you can see yesterday, boiled eggs. Delicious and filling, and I'm still losing weight. Farang priced at 100 baht though.
